This highly illustrated swashbuckling title is a visual treat and a book for the whole family to treasure as the discover the real pirates of the Caribbean (and elsewhere). In Pirates: True Stories of Seafaring Rogues, Anne Rooney explore pirates throughout history and across the globe, coming face to face with some of the most villainous and scurrilous rogues ever to sail the seven seas. Included are the notorious Blackbeard, who terrorised the Caribbean and the Atlantic seaboard of America until he met his end in a dramatic shoot-out; and Captain Kidd, who might be the unluckiest pirate of all time, and whose legendary treasure is still sought after. These in-depth pirate profiles are interspersed with highly visual maps and high-interest themed spreads exploring all the incredible details of life as a pirate on the high seas.
